Product liability refers to the legal responsibility of manufacturers, distributors, and sellers for injuries caused by defective or harmful products. This area of law ensures that consumers can seek compensation when products fail to perform safely as expected.
Successful product liability claims typically require proving that the product was defective, the defect caused injury, and that the product was used as intended. The process includes collecting evidence, consulting experts, and negotiating or litigating claims to achieve fair compensation.

In Minnesota, the statute of limitations for filing a product liability lawsuit is generally two years from the date the injury was discovered or should have been discovered. This means you must act within this timeframe or risk losing your ability to file a claim. Product liability cases in Minnesota often rely on strict liability, which means you do not have to prove the manufacturer was negligent. Instead, showing that the product was defective and caused your injury is sufficient. However, some claims may also involve negligence if the manufacturer failed to exercise reasonable care. Filing a claim after misusing a product can be challenging, but not always impossible. The key issue is whether improper use was a significant cause of the injury or if a defect made the product unsafe even when used normally. Product liability cases specifically focus on injuries caused by defective or unsafe products, while general personal injury claims may arise from accidents or negligence unrelated to products. The laws and legal standards differ for product liability, often involving strict liability, making these claims unique in how responsibility is established.
